Point Blank is a small city in San Jacinto County, in East Texas, on the northwest shore of Lake Livingston about 85 miles north of Houston. It sits at the junction of U.S. Highway 190 and State Highway 156, where the Trinity River was dammed to form one of the largest reservoirs in Texas. The community was named "Blanc Point" around 1850 by Florence Dissiway, a French governess, and the name evolved into Point Blank over time. It incorporated in 1975 and remains one of the county's smaller municipalities. The town's identity is tied to the lake. Lake Livingston is a sprawling reservoir popular for fishing, boating, and waterfront living, and Point Blank serves as a gateway to its northwest shore. The area around the city is a mix of lakefront homes, lake-view lots, rural acreage, and quiet residential streets, and its median age and homeownership patterns reflect a population weighted toward retirees, empty nesters, and lake-home owners rather than young families. Point Blank offers few commercial amenities of its own, and there are no school campuses within the city's 77364 ZIP code; students attend schools in the nearby Livingston and Onalaska districts. Residents rely on Livingston, about 10 miles east, for shopping, services, and health care, while Huntsville and the Houston metro are within a reasonable drive. Point Blank suits people who want space, lake access, and a quiet pace above all else. It is a place for those drawn to Lake Livingston's fishing and recreation and willing to trade walkable amenities for larger lots and a relaxed, rural setting. Seasonal and second-home residents are common, giving the community a laid-back, waterfront character year-round.

About Point Blank

Real Estate & Housing

Point Blank's housing stock centers on lake-area living. Buyers find a mix of lakefront and lake-view homes, modest single-family houses, manufactured homes, and larger rural lots, with many properties oriented toward recreation rather than traditional suburban living. The city spans just over two square miles, and the surrounding San Jacinto County countryside adds acreage and wooded homesites. The market draws retirees, empty nesters, and second-home buyers seeking Lake Livingston access at a generally affordable level.

Neighborhoods

Point Blank is less a collection of distinct neighborhoods than a scattered lake community. Development follows U.S. 190, State Highway 156, and the roads that lead down to Lake Livingston's northwest shore, where lakefront homes and subdivisions cluster around boat ramps and marinas. Inland, wooded lots and rural acreage predominate. The area's quiet, spread-out character reflects its identity as a retirement and lake-retreat destination rather than a dense residential town.

Lifestyle in Point Blank

Life in Point Blank is centered on the lake and the outdoors. Residents fish, boat, and relax along Lake Livingston's shoreline, and many homes are seasonal retreats for weekend and summer use. The pace is slow and unhurried, with little commercial activity in town and a reliance on nearby Livingston for services. Community life is casual and neighborly, built around lake clubs, churches, and the shared enjoyment of waterfront living in the Piney Woods of East Texas.

Schools & Education

There are no school campuses within Point Blank itself, and students attend public schools in the nearby Livingston and Onalaska districts, requiring a short commute. Both districts serve the broader Lake Livingston area, and school choice and transportation are practical considerations for families considering the community. Given its demographic mix, the city skews toward retirees and second-home owners, with fewer families than the surrounding school-centered towns.

Getting Around

Point Blank sits at the junction of U.S. Highway 190 and State Highway 156, on the northwest side of Lake Livingston. U.S. 190 connects east to Livingston, the county's commercial hub about 10 miles away, and west toward Huntsville and Interstate 45. Houston lies about 85 miles south, reachable via U.S. 190 and I-45, making the city a practical weekend destination and, for some, a commuter base into the northern reaches of the Houston metro.

Parks & Recreation

Recreation in Point Blank revolves around Lake Livingston, one of Texas's largest reservoirs. The lake offers fishing for bass, catfish, and crappie, along with boating, water skiing, and swimming, with public boat ramps and marinas along the northwest shore. The surrounding Piney Woods provide hunting and outdoor recreation, and Sam Houston National Forest lies to the west. It is a quiet, water-oriented setting well suited to fishing enthusiasts and lake-home owners.

Frequently asked questions

What county is Point Blank in?

Point Blank is in San Jacinto County, in East Texas, on the northwest shore of Lake Livingston about 85 miles north of Houston. It incorporated in 1975 and remains one of the county's smaller municipalities.

What lake is Point Blank on?

Point Blank sits on the northwest shore of Lake Livingston, one of Texas's largest reservoirs, formed by damming the Trinity River. The lake is popular for bass, catfish, and crappie fishing, along with boating, water skiing, and waterfront living.

What school district serves Point Blank?

There are no school campuses within Point Blank's 77364 ZIP code. Students attend public schools in the nearby Livingston and Onalaska districts, a short commute from the city, which is a consideration for families moving to the area.

How far is Point Blank from Houston?

Point Blank is about 85 miles north of Houston, reachable via U.S. Highway 190 and Interstate 45. Livingston, the nearest commercial hub, is about 10 miles east, and Huntsville lies to the west.

How did Point Blank get its name?

The community was originally called 'Blanc Point,' a name given around 1850 by Florence Dissiway, a French governess who worked for a local family. The name was later changed to Point Blank, and the city incorporated under that name in 1975.
